Sony reveals newer re-designed PlayStation 3 console

Sony has finally revealed its previously rumoured re-designed PlayStation 3 console at the Tokyo Game Show, and it’s safe to say that someone’s been busy nipping and tucking in the design department.

The new PlayStation 3 console is 20 per cent lighter then the existing version, with 25 per cent less weight to boot.

It will arrive bearing traditional black colours, though if you’re planning a trip to Japan anytime soon you’ll be able to snap one up in white as well.

Storage-wise, the new PlayStation 3 will be rocking upgraded 500GB and 350GB hard drives, replacing the existing 320GB and 160GB models respectively.

UAE gamers will also have the option to snap up a cheaper (but still HDD upgradeable) 12GB flash-toting model, though specific UAE pricing deals have been kept under wraps for the time being.

The hard drive models are set to hit shelves on September 28th while the flash-toting 12GB model will launch on October 12th. Game on.
